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28777 63 73144 2605524849
6242 0587855 273378
6242 0587855 273378
15505473 027 50140531869
All about undefined
Interested in learning more?
6242 0587855 273378
15505473 027 50140531869
See more
0112693960 59612818 53102320
96 227692 70784
See more
03 36457017
9525042 70802233 96 35335071 5029024
See more